Web4. There's no single word to describe making software more robust. Some ways of making software more robust are: simplify, debug, re-factor (especially functional decomposition and code re-use), make the interface more user friendly, make the program resilient to input errors and even recover from some runtime errors, etc. Share. WebRobustness is the ability of a computing system to handle the errors throughout execution and manage the inaccurate input of information. Java is considered as a robust and strong programming language as it features strong memory management and since Java doesn't use any types of pointers which bypasses security dilemmas. WebSep 30, 2024 · Robust vocabulary instruction is a crucial driver of knowledge-building. While many knowledge-rich curricula might emphasize the importance of vocabulary and identify key vocabulary words in each lesson (typically Tier Three), ultimately the quality and robustness of vocabulary instruction comes down to teacher expertise and judgement.
